Output 23fc07ca793125f179a0260f511ecbdafa78a83b94f29c9b26c3c2c20d01d8f0:0

value
2689726
script pubkey
OP_0 OP_PUSHBYTES_20 1dee914ce910be1e570aaba0b79ed1444146fc0c
address
bc1qrhhfzn8fzzlpu4c24wst08k3g3q5dlqvydkw9u
transaction
23fc07ca793125f179a0260f511ecbdafa78a83b94f29c9b26c3c2c20d01d8f0
spent
true